Distrust!

• Proclamation Line of 1763 & sent 10,000 troops

• Colonists can not move west of the Appalachian Mts. – this land will be reserved for Native Americans

• Colonists frustrated and moved anyway

Quartering Act

• Colonists had to allow soldiers to live in their homes.

• Colonists had to give them food, fuel, candles, beer, & transportation.

• King George III passes “writs of assistance,” 1767- search warrants.

Stamp Act• A tax on almost all printed

material (newspapers, playing cards, wills)

• Colonists Respond!• Taxation Without Representation!• Patrick Henry, VA, persuaded the

people to protest.• Samuel Adams and Paul Revere

started the “Sons of Liberty”- group that protested in the streets.

• Boycotted British goods• Burned effigies of tax collectors• Raided and destroyed royal

officials’ houses

Britain Responds to the Stamp Act Protest!

• March, 1766, Parliament repealed the Stamp Act.

• Colonists were happy, but never really trusted the king again.

• On the same day that the Stamp Act was gone, Parliament passed a new law:

• Declaratory Act- Parliament had the right to tax the colonies!

Boston Massacre • There were more than

10,000 redcoats in the colonies, but mainly in Boston.

• The colonists hated the soldiers being there!

• On Mar. 5, 1770, patriots began harassing the soldiers. They threw rocks, snowballs, sticks, but the soldiers were told to stay calm.

• One of the soldiers fell/was knocked down. Someone in the crowd yelled “fire” & the soldiers fired.

• 5 patriots were killed, including a black man, Crispus Attucks.

Patriots respond!

• Samuel Adams put up posters & spread propaganda against the British.

• He started the “committees of correspondence” in 1772, which spread writings against the British.

• Paul Revere did several engravings of the Massacre.

• Patriots boycotted British goods.
